Analysts’ Opinion of AXP

Many brokerage firms have already submitted their reports for AXP stocks, with Redburn Atlantic repeating the rating for AXP by listing it as a “Neutral.” The predicted price for AXP in the upcoming period, according to Redburn Atlantic is $255 based on the research report published on April 23, 2025 of the current year 2025.

Monness Crespi & Hardt, on the other hand, stated in their research note that they expect to see AXP reach a price target of $285, previously predicting the price at $275. The rating they have provided for AXP stocks is “Buy” according to the report published on April 21st, 2025.

BofA Securities gave a rating of “Buy” to AXP, setting the target price at $274 in the report published on April 11th of the current year.

Insider Trading

Reports are indicating that there were more than several insider trading activities at AXP starting from Marquez Rafael, who sale 12,000 shares at the price of $296.93 back on May 20 ’25. After this action, Marquez Rafael now owns 8,078 shares of American Express Co, valued at $3,563,160 using the latest closing price.
